Description
East Riding of Yorkshire Council BAND:F. Tenure: Freehold.
The Accommodation Comprises -
Entrance Hall - Solid oak front entrance door, wooden veneer flooring, two radiators, an oak staircase leading to the first floor with a cupboard underneath, and ceiling coving.
Sitting Room - 6.49m x 5.28m (21'3" x 17'3") - Solid oak front entrance door, wooden veneer flooring, two radiators, an oak staircase leading to the first floor with a cupboard underneath, and ceiling coving.
Open Plan Kitchen/Family Room - 8.04m max x 10.60m (26'4" max x 34'9") - The kitchen is fitted with a range of solid oak wall and base units with quartz worktops. A large island unit includes an inset sink with a Quooker boiling tap, integrated dishwasher and fridge, under-counter bins, and a breakfast bar. There is a Rangemaster cooker set within an alcove with cupboards to either side. The room has recessed ceiling lights, two skylights, and windows overlooking the garden. The flooring is porcelain tiled with underfloor heating, and there is surround sound in the family area.
Utility - 2.14m x 3.98m (7'0" x 13'0") - Fitted wall and base units with work surfaces, a single drainer sink unit, plumbing for an automatic washer, and ceiling coving.
Wc - Two piece white suite, comprising of a low flush WC, pedestal wash hand basin, ceiling coving, radiator.
Dining Room - 3.77m x 4.34m (12'4" x 14'2") - Laminate flooring, ceiling coving, radiator, and a gas fire with a stone-effect hearth and surround.
Snug - 4.59m max x 4.34m (15'0" max x 14'2") - Gas fire with a stone-effect hearth and surround, ceiling coving, laminate flooring, wall light points, a radiator, and stairs to the first floor.
First Floor Accommodation -
Landing - Ceiling coving, radiator.
Bedroom One - 4.56m x 5.28m (14'11" x 17'3") - Two radiators, picture rail, recessed ceiling lights, door leading to Juliet balcony.
En Suite - Three-piece white suite comprising a walk-in shower cubicle with waterfall shower, wash hand basin, and low-level flush WC. Beautifully fitted cupboards with a matching mirror, underfloor heating, fully tiled walls and floor, and a chrome heated towel rail.
Bedroom Two - 3.75m x 5.26m (12'3" x 17'3") - Radiator, ceiling coving, access to roof space.
Bedroom Three - 3.64m x 5.32m max (11'11" x 17'5" max) - Two radiators, ceiling coving.
Bathroom - Three-piece suite comprising a corner bath, low-level flush WC, and pedestal wash hand basin, with a chrome heated towel rail, part-tiled walls, ceiling coving, and laminate flooring.
Bedroom Four - 3.45m x 4.39m (11'3" x 14'4") - Radiator, ceiling coving.
Bedroom Five - 2.64m x 3.64m (8'7" x 11'11") - Radiator, ceiling coving.
Bedroom Six - 2.76m x 2.43m (9'0" x 7'11") - Radiator, access to roof space.
Bathroom - Three-piece white suite comprising a copper roll-top bath, low-level flush WC, and wash hand basin with beautifully fitted cupboards and a matching mirror. Ceiling coving, recessed ceiling lights, tiled floor, a traditional radiator, and a fitted cupboard housing the hot water cylinder.
Outside - The outdoor space is a standout feature, offering privacy and tranquillity in a beautiful rural setting. A generous Indian stone patio is perfect for outdoor dining, leading onto an extensive lawn bordered by mature trees and hedging, with open views across the countryside. Additional benefits include a charming garden pond, gated access, ample block-paved parking, and a garage with loft storage.
Garage - 5.58m x 5.68m (18'3" x 18'7") - Up and over door, rear door, power and light, loft/storage area.
Additional Information -
Services - Mains water, electricity, oil-fired heating with bunded oil tank, air-fed septic system, owned solar panels with battery storage (off-grid), Starlink internet, and EV charging point.
